How Nuclear Explosion Blast Radius Explained: Risks You Cant Ignore! Actually Works

A nuclear explosion’s blast radius refers to the area impacted by the initial blast wave generated as energy releases faster than the speed of sound. This shockwave travels outward in concentric rings, delivering extreme pressure that can flatten structures, damage infrastructure, and cause life-threatening injuries far beyond the immediate fireball. The radius depends on yield strength (measured in kilotons to megatons), altitude of detonation, terrain, and environmental conditions.

Q: What exactly defines the blast radius, and how far does it extend?
The blast radius begins at the point where pressure from the shockwave exceeds structural integrity. Typically, a nuclear blast effects zone spans from near zero to several kilometers outward depending on yield—within seconds, buildings collapse, and dense damage zones form.
